Style and Technique
Dina Rubina's novel «The White Dove of Cordoba» is distinguished by its rich and expressive language, allowing readers to deeply immerse themselves in the atmosphere of the narrative. The author employs numerous metaphors and epithets, creating vivid and memorable images. The storytelling style is characterized by its complexity and richness, which allows for the exploration of the characters' inner worlds and their intricate relationships. Literary techniques such as retrospection and parallel plot lines help create a dynamic and engaging narrative. The structure of the novel is designed so that the reader gradually delves into the story, uncovering new details and plot twists. Special attention is given to the description of settings, which adds a unique atmosphere and color to the work.
